
An area school district’s administration has made the decision to move to distance learning for the next few days school is scheduled to be in session.
According to a release from Malta Bend R-5 Superintendent John Angelhow, due to the frigid weather that is expected over the next few days, the district will be transitioning to Distance Learning. The time frame the district has set for this episode will be:
Friday, February 12- Distance Learning;
Monday, February 15- Presidents’ Day, No School;
Tuesday, February 16- Distance Learning; and
Wednesday, February 17- Return to In-Person Learning (weather permitting).
